
Oscar Motuloh
Oscar Motuloh is a prominent figure in Indonesian photojournalism, serving as a member of the Ethical Council of the Pewarta Foto Indonesia and the founder of Yayasan Riset Visual Mata Waktu. He is recognized for his contributions to visual research and journalism, often advocating for ethical standards in photojournalism.
